The Role of Technology in Sustainability

Technology is essential for achieving a more sustainable future, and in the fashion industry, its potential is huge. Technological innovations can help improve efficiency in production and distribution, reduce the waste, and promote the use of sustainable materials. For example, 3D printing and additive manufacturing help minimize waste in production, while artificial intelligence optimizes supply chains and reduces environmental impact.

 

The Importance of Education and Awareness

 

Education and awareness play a key role in the development of sustainability. Consumers must be informed about the environmental and social impact of their purchases and have access to responsible options. Brands, in their side, must be transparent in their production and distribution practices, in addition to implementing recovery, reuse, and waste reduction programs.

 

In Latin America, awareness of the importance of sustainability in fashion is growing. Consumers are increasingly interested in purchasing products that are not only visually attractive but also environmentally responsible and socially just. Brands leading this change are finding that sustainability can be a competitive advantage: consumers are willing to pay a little more for these products. 

 

Brands Leading the Change

 

D.R.Y. Coats, an Argentine brand, has found a unique way to combine sustainability with design. It specializes in recovering unused umbrellas to create unique, gender-neutral clothing and accessories. Its goal is to reduce this particular waste and transform it into durable products. D.R.Y. Coats bets for fashion with a lower impact, without destroying or polluting the planet in the production process.

 

 

In Chile, Piña Zero Waste is a sustainable venture that promotes the circular economy. It uses recycled plastic to create long-lasting sustainable fashion. Each of its products reuses around 50 plastic bags, and the founder, Carolina, plans to expand production to provide jobs for women and increase the amount of plastic being reused. This brand not only contributes to the environment but also creates a positive social impact, proving that circular fashion can be a transformative force.

 

INNER Fashion Solutions, located in Uruguay, specializes in providing digital patterning services, 2D and 3D design, pattern grading/progression, size charts, and technical sheets. Through its technological solutions, INNER facilitates more efficient and sustainable production in the fashion industry, enabling brands to create products with a lower environmental impact while optimizing development and production processes.
